Output 32fca1a92d7cee7b4e7bfdf63c7731014b8dee51b03c080d31010813be353526:3

value
954736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044e5c71517551d402f02a68defc700d701d2536 OP_EQUAL
address
325nVwF65yBhAHrwovicckXupV1J2g4Wq3
transaction
32fca1a92d7cee7b4e7bfdf63c7731014b8dee51b03c080d31010813be353526
confirmations
98635
spent
true